The IEEE Signal Processing Society (SPS) Board of Governors, at the 11 September 2003 meeting in Newark, New Jersey, USA, approved changes to the Society´s Constitution and Bylaws. As required by the Bylaws, changes are published for member comment and become effective 30 days following completion of the comment period and approval by the IEEE Technical Activities Board. The SPS Board of Governors held two long-range planning retreats in May 2001 and September 2002. As a result of those retreats, the Board created a vision statement for the Society and also updated the mission statement to better reflect the Society´s purpose. The changes approved unanimously by the Society´s Board of Governors are presented.
